Key Skills to Look For
Recruitment and Talent Management
A senior HR officer should have a proven track record in recruitment, talent management, and succession planning. They should be adept at using various recruitment tools and platforms.
Knowledge of Labor Laws
Understanding Indian labor laws, including compliance and regulatory requirements, is crucial. They should be able to advise on legal matters related to employment.
Employee Relations and Engagement
Skills in managing employee relations, improving employee engagement, and handling conflicts are essential for a senior HR role.
HR Systems and Technology
Familiarity with HR systems, including HRIS, payroll software, and performance management tools, is necessary.
Training and Development
The ability to design and implement training programs that enhance employee skills and knowledge is vital.
Analytics and Reporting
A senior HR officer should be able to analyze HR data and provide insights that inform business decisions.
Communication and Interpersonal Skills
Strong communication and interpersonal skills are required to effectively interact with employees at all levels.
Strategic Thinking
The ability to think strategically and align HR functions with business objectives is key.

Sample Interview Questions for Senior Human Resources Officer
- What strategies do you use for talent acquisition and retention?
- How do you handle employee conflicts or grievances?
- Can you describe your experience with HR software and systems?
- How do you ensure compliance with labor laws and regulations?
- What approaches do you take to improve employee engagement?
- How do you measure the success of HR initiatives?
